Charlotte LaSasso

Charlotte LaSasso joined the Boulder County Arts Alliance staff as the Communications Assistant in February 2004 and was promoted to Communications Coordinator, Manager and finally Communications Director in January 2008. Her regular duties include processing memberships, grant and exhibit applications, writing and sending press releases, email and print newsletters; maintaining the website; updating program information; and assisting with other communications, marketing and programming activities. Recently Charlotte's responsibilities expanded to include oversight of the BCAA Calendar Project - creation of a shared, web-based arts event submission and extraction process.  Throughout 2009 she will continue work on the BCAA Multicultural Competency and Inclusiveness Initiative funded by the Boulder Arts Commission.  Charlotte also volunteers in an administrative capacity and on a project basis for a national nonprofit organization. When a compelling opportunity presents itself, Charlotte is a curator and an installation artist.


Our Volunteers

BCAA's many accomplishments would not have been possible without the wonderful people behind the scenes providing valuable time and expertise.  We are proud of  the high level of service that we provide to our members and the community with an active, dedicated and creative Volunteer Corps which logs over 2,000 hours annually.  In 2003, BCAA inaugurated a Volunteer of the Year award to acknowledge and show our appreciation to a volunteer who provided extraordinary service to the organzation.  Recipients include:
